Abstract
BACKGROUND The use of bivalirudin-based anticoagulation over heparin-based anticoagulation for coronary percutaneous intervention has been debated for a long time. Multiple trials have shown promising benefits of bivalirudin over heparin therapy with the most recent addition being the BRIGHT-4 trial. We performed a meta-analysis to assess evidence from these trials, focusing on the coronary intervention of the STEMI population. METHODS This meta-analysis was performed based on PRISMA guidelines after registering in PROSPERO (CRD42023394701). Databases were searched for relevant articles published before January 2023. Pertinent data from the included studies were extracted and analyzed using RevMan v5.4. RESULTS Out of 2375 studies evaluated, 13 randomized control trials with 24 360 acute ST-elevation myocardial infarction patients were included for analysis. The bivalirudin-based anticoagulation reduced the net clinical events (OR 0.75, CI 0.61-0.92), major adverse cardiac or cerebral events (OR 0.85, CI 0.74-0.98), any bleeding (OR 0.61, CI 0.45-0.83), major bleeding (OR 0.54, CI 0.39-0.75), all-cause mortality (OR 0.79, CI 0.67-0.92) and cardiac mortality (OR 0.78, CI 0.65-0.93) significantly without increasing the risk of any stent thrombosis (OR 0.92, 95% CI 0.52-1.61), definite stent thrombosis (OR 1.17, 95% CI 0.62-2.22) and acute stent thrombosis (OR 2.06, 95% CI 0.69-6.09) significantly at 30 days. CONCLUSION Based on this meta-analysis, bivalirudin plus a post-PCI high-dose infusion-based anticoagulation during STEMI PCI has significant benefits over heparin therapy for cardiovascular outcomes without a significant increase in the risk of thrombotic outcomes.

Abstract
BACKGROUND Bivalirudin is associated with fewer major bleeding events than heparin in patients undergoing percutaneous coronary intervention (PCI), but confounding effects of concomitant glycoprotein IIb/IIIa inhibitors, routine femoral artery access, and less potent effects of clopidogrel limits meaningful comparisons. The present study is a systematic review and meta-analysis to compare bivalirudin to heparin in contemporary practice. METHODS The Cochrane Library, PubMed, EMBASE, and Ovid MEDLINE databases were searched for relevant studies, including comparisons between bivalirudin and heparin in the current medical era from inception to December 23, 2021. Studies reporting incidences of major adverse cardiac events (MACE) and net adverse clinical events (NACE) in patients undergoing PCI and meeting the inclusion criteria were retained. Data extraction was performed by three independent reviewers. RESULTS The meta-analysis included 8 studies. Compared to heparin, bivalirudin during PCI was associated with a lower NACE risk, lower all-cause death, and similar MACE risk, with a pooled risk ratio of 0.82 (95% confidence interval [CI] 0.69-0.97, p = 0.02), 0.83 (95% CI 0.74-0.94, p = 0.002), and 0.93 (95% CI 0.78-1.10, p = 0.38), respectively. Moreover, the reduction in NACE was mainly attributed to reduced bleeding (22% reduction in the risk of major bleeding, 95% CI 0.63-0.97, p = 0.03). CONCLUSIONS These findings suggest that bivalirudin use during PCI reduced the risk of NACE and all-cause death but did not reduce the risk of MACE compared with heparin use in PCI. More studies specifically designed for anticoagulation strategies and a personalized anticoagulation regimen to comprehensively balance bleeding and ischemia risks are required.

Abstract
Although bivalirudin has been recently made available for purchase in China, large-scale analyses on the safety profile of bivalirudin among Chinese patients is lacking. Thus, this study aimed to compare the safety profile of bivalirudin and heparin as anticoagulants in Chinese ST-segment elevation myocardial infarction (STEMI) patients undergoing percutaneous coronary intervention (PCI). A total of 1063 STEMI patients undergoing PCI and receiving bivalirudin (n=424, bivalirudin group) or heparin (n=639, heparin group) as anticoagulants were retrospectively enrolled. The net adverse clinical events (NACEs) within 30 days after PCI were recorded, including major adverse cardiac and cerebral events (MACCEs) and bleeding events (bleeding academic research consortium (BARC) grades 2-5 (BARC 2-5)). The incidences of NACEs (10.1 vs 15.6%) (P=0.010), BARC 2-5 bleeding events (5.2 vs 10.3%) (P=0.003), and BARC grades 3-5 (BARC 3-5) bleeding events (2.1 vs 5.5%) (P=0.007) were lower in the bivalirudin group compared to the heparin group, whereas general MACCEs incidence (8.9 vs 6.4%) (P=0.131) and each category of MACCEs (all P>0.05) did not differ between two groups. Furthermore, the multivariate logistic analyses showed that bivalirudin (vs heparin) was independently correlated with lower risk of NACEs (OR=0.508, P=0.002), BARC 2-5 bleeding events (OR=0.403, P=0.001), and BARC 3-5 bleeding events (OR=0.452, P=0.042); other independent risk factors for NACEs, MACCEs, or BARC bleeding events included history of diabetes mellitus, emergency operation, multiple lesional vessels, stent length >33.0 mm, and higher CRUSADE score (all P<0.05). Thus, bivalirudin presented a better safety profile than heparin among Chinese STEMI patients undergoing PCI.

Abstract
Bivalirudin, as a direct thrombin inhibitor, is considered to be safer compared with other anticoagulants, such as heparin; however, relevant data in China are unclear. The present study aimed to compare the safety of bivalirudin and heparin as anticoagulants in Chinese patients who underwent percutaneous coronary intervention (PCI). In the present study, 2,377 patients with ST-segment elevation myocardial infarction (STEMI), unstable angina, non-STEMI or stable coronary artery disease who underwent primary PCI while receiving bivalirudin or heparin (low molecular weight heparin or unfractionated heparin) were reviewed, and then analyzed as the bivalirudin group (n=944) and heparin group (n=1,433). The net adverse clinical events (NACEs) within 30 days were obtained, which were defined as major adverse cardiac and cerebral events (MACCEs) + Bleeding Academic Research Consortium (BARC) grade 2-5 bleeding events. Compared with the heparin group, the incidence of NACEs was reduced in the bivalirudin group (9.3 vs. 13.4%; P=0.003). However, no discrepancy was found in the incidence of MACCEs between the groups (5.9 vs. 7.6%; P=0.116). Moreover, the incidences of BARC 2-5 (4.8 vs. 8.7%; P<0.001) and BARC 3-5 bleeding events (1.9 vs. 4.4%; P=0.001) were decreased in the bivalirudin group compared with the heparin group. Following adjustment using multivariate logistic regression analysis, bivalirudin treatment (vs. heparin treatment) was independently associated with lower risks of NACEs [odds ratio (OR), 0.587; P<0.001], MACCEs (OR, 0.689; P=0.041) and BARC 2-5 (OR, 0.459; P<0.001) and 3-5 bleeding events (OR, 0.386; P=0.002). Overall, the present study demonstrated that bivalirudin decreased the risks of NACEs and bleeding events compared with heparin in Chinese patients who undergo PCI. However, further validation is required.

Abstract
Background This prospective, multi-center, intensive monitoring study aimed to systematically assess the occurrence of adverse events (AEs) and adverse drug reactions (ADRs), especially thrombocytopenia and bleeding, as well as their risk factors in Chinese ST-segment elevation myocardial infraction (STEMI) patients receiving bivalirudin as anticoagulant for percutaneous coronary intervention (PCI). Methods In total, 1244 STEMI patients undergoing PCI and receiving bivalirudin as anticoagulant were enrolled in the present study. Safety data were collected from hospital admission to 72 h after bivalirudin administration; in addition, patients were further followed up at the 30th day with safety data collected at that time. Results AEs, severe AEs, ADRs and severe ADRs were reported in 224 (18.0%), 15 (1.2%), 49 (3.9%) and 5 (0.4%) patients, respectively. Importantly, 4 (0.3%) patients were submitted to hospitalization and 6 (0.5%) patients died due to AEs, while 1 (0.1%) patient was submitted to hospitalization but no (0.0%) patient died due to ADRs. Meanwhile, thrombocytopenia and bleeding occurred in 24 (1.9%) and 21 (1.7%) patients, respectively. Further multivariate logistic analysis identified several important independent factors related to AEs, ADRs, thrombocytopenia or bleeding, which included history of cardiac surgery and renal function impairment, high CRUSADE risk stratification, elective operation and combination with glycoprotein IIb/IIIa inhibitors. Moreover, 4 multivariate models were constructed based on the above-mentioned factors, which all showed acceptable predictive value for AEs, ADRs, thrombocytopenia and bleeding, respectively. Conclusion Bivalirudin is a well-tolerant anticoagulant in Chinese STEMI patients undergoing PCI procedure. Abstract
Background This study aimed to comprehensively explore the occurrence and risk factors for adverse events (AEs) and adverse drug reactions (ADRs) (especially for thrombocytopenia and bleeding) in Chinese patients with high bleeding risk (older adults, or complicated with diabetes mellitus or renal function impairment) undergoing percutaneous coronary intervention (PCI) with bivalirudin as an anticoagulant. Methods A total of 1,226 patients with high bleeding risk who received PCI with bivalirudin as an anticoagulant from 27 Chinese medical centers were enrolled in this prospective, multi-center, intensive monitoring study. AEs, ADRs, thrombocytopenia, and bleeding were collected from admission to 72 h post-bivalirudin administration; subsequently, patients were followed up on the 30th day with the safety data collected as well. Results Adverse events were observed in 198 (16.2) patients, among which severe AEs occurred in 16 (1.3%) patients. Meanwhile, bivalirudin-related ADRs were reported in 66 (5.4%) patients, among which 5 (0.4%) patients experienced bivalirudin-related severe ADRs. Besides, thrombocytopenia and bleeding occurred in 45 (3.7%) and 19 (1.5%) patients, respectively. The subsequent multivariate logistic analysis revealed that age >75 years [p = 0.017, odds ratio (OR) = 1.856] and spontaneous coronary artery dissection (SCAD) (p = 0.030, OR = 2.022) were independently related to higher ADR risk; SCAD (p = 0.017, OR = 2.426) was independently correlated with higher thrombocytopenia risk, while radial artery access (p = 0.015, OR = 0.352) was independently correlated with lower thrombocytopenia risk; and the administration of bivalirudin preoperatively or intraoperatively (p = 0.013, OR = 5.097) was independently associated with higher bleeding risk. Conclusion Bivalirudin presents a favorable safety profile regarding ADRs, thrombocytopenia, and bleeding in Chinese patients with high bleeding risk undergoing PCI.
